Performs technical and administrative duties in implementation and coordination of Human Resources functions and programs.

Work Situation Factors:

Position involves competing demands, performing multiple tasks, working to deadlines, occasional work beyond normal business hours, and responding to customer issues. Regular attendance is an essential function of this job to ensure continuity of services. Position is subject to drug testing in accordance with applicable State and Federal regulations and City of Las Cruces policies.

Physical Factors:

Light physical demands, mostly desk work, with frequent to constant use of a personal computer.

Environmental Factors:

Work is performed in a standard office setting; dealing with the public and providing customer service.

This position is graded RN12.

  • Reviews and processes personnel actions to execute salary and status changes, and other related transactions; assures accuracy of information and data entry to comply with established policies and procedures; prepares and processes documents and information in an accurate and timely manner to ensure records are current and readily available.
  • Reviews, routes, and processes applications, enrollments, information, documents, and data; assists with recruitment processes; coordinates, administers, and evaluates examinations and skills assessments to provide support to HR Analysts and hiring managers.
  • Prepares and presents various special and recurring reports and enters and updates data in various mediums, formats, and filing systems to provide timely and accurate information.
  • Routes documentation and information as directed and required; maintains confidentiality of all work-related matters, personnel records, and information.
  • In-processes newly-hired employees and delivers orientation to provide information on the organization, policies, and procedures; provides direction and assistance with completion of all required forms and documentation to comply with established policies, proc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• Performs various technical and administrative functions to assure all duties are accomplished according to governing laws and City policies and procedures; collects financial, technical, and administrative information to compile data for reports; monitors documents for compliance with policies and practices; provides appropriate levels of service and assistance to meet customer service goals and expectations.
  • Responds to requests for information and assistance, greets and assists visitors, and provides technical information and assistance within scope of authority.
  • Provides and delivers training regarding policies, procedures, processes, and programs; assists with special projects as directed and required.

Equivalent of a High School diploma AND two (2) years of experience working in support of related functions, duties, and responsibilities. A combination of education, experience, and training may be applied in accordance with City of Las Cruces policy.

Knowledge of: principles, practices, techniques, activities, rules, and regulations related to the operations and functions of human resources administration in the public sector; regulations, policies, and procedures related to employment, benefits, and compensation; current principles and practices of confidential records and file management; principles and techniques of current office management practices and procedures; customer service and effective communication principles, standards, and methods;

methods and standards for preparing business correspondence, appropriate business English, spelling, grammar, punctuation, proofreading and editing; business mathematics; modern office equipment, business and personal computers, business office software applications, and report generation;
City organization and related regulations, operations, and policies and procedures to effectively perform the required functions and duties of the position.
Ability to: perform a variety of duties and responsibilities and assess and prioritize multiple tasks, projects, and demands to meet critical deadlines; ensure appropriate levels of customer service to achieve expectations and meet objectives; read, understand, and assure compliance with a variety of policies, procedures, and regulations governing related activities, programs, and functions; research and compile applicable information and maintain timely and accurate records;
